The Prague 2026 Chess Festival concluded with a series of games that left a deep impression, selected and widely introduced by ChessBase Magazine #225. Issue 225 of this in-depth chess magazine is not only a collection of highly entertaining miniatures but also a valuable training tool for the global chess community. With 27 short, dramatic games, top analysts including Aravindh, Anish Giri, Gurel, David Navara, and other experts have contributed to this issue. Each miniature offers valuable lessons on tactics, openings, and endings, helping readers – from amateurs to experts – apply them immediately in real games. In the context of the event held in Prague, where the atmosphere is vibrant and highly competitive, these analyses have been emphasized in depth, particularly the opening videos featuring Werle, King, and Ris. These experts do not merely record moves but explore deeply into new ideas, helping readers understand how opening solutions are constructed and developed in practice.
